Waay back in June I posted a reply to this thread - remarking that maybe I should keep my 4 week old Cuckoo Marans roo. And I did. And my husband and I love him! Nubs is a gorgeous and gentle boy (6 months old now) and we get to watch an 'Animal Planet' episode every time we let him and his 9 girls out to free range in the afternoon. He has already protected them from hawks and eagles and diligently watches out for them while they are out free ranging, and he lets them know when he has found some sort of treat (good bye blue berries!). We are in a coyote area and the back part of our property is woods so I know that one day I'll have a fatality or 2, I just hope Nubs can keep the girls safe anyway. The only downside is - Nubs won't shut up! Loves the sound of his own voice!!
